quantum_keycodes_legacy.h 3.6 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576777879
  1. #pragma once
  2. // clang-format off
  3. // Deprecated Quantum keycodes
  4. #define KC_LEAD QK_LEADER
  5. #define KC_LOCK QK_LOCK
  6. #define VLK_TOG QK_VELOCIKEY_TOGGLE
  7. #define PROGRAMMABLE_BUTTON_1 QK_PROGRAMMABLE_BUTTON_1
  8. #define PROGRAMMABLE_BUTTON_2 QK_PROGRAMMABLE_BUTTON_2
  9. #define PROGRAMMABLE_BUTTON_3 QK_PROGRAMMABLE_BUTTON_3
  10. #define PROGRAMMABLE_BUTTON_4 QK_PROGRAMMABLE_BUTTON_4
  11. #define PROGRAMMABLE_BUTTON_5 QK_PROGRAMMABLE_BUTTON_5
  12. #define PROGRAMMABLE_BUTTON_6 QK_PROGRAMMABLE_BUTTON_6
  13. #define PROGRAMMABLE_BUTTON_7 QK_PROGRAMMABLE_BUTTON_7
  14. #define PROGRAMMABLE_BUTTON_8 QK_PROGRAMMABLE_BUTTON_8
  15. #define PROGRAMMABLE_BUTTON_9 QK_PROGRAMMABLE_BUTTON_9
  16. #define PROGRAMMABLE_BUTTON_10 QK_PROGRAMMABLE_BUTTON_10
  17. #define PROGRAMMABLE_BUTTON_11 QK_PROGRAMMABLE_BUTTON_11
  18. #define PROGRAMMABLE_BUTTON_12 QK_PROGRAMMABLE_BUTTON_12
  19. #define PROGRAMMABLE_BUTTON_13 QK_PROGRAMMABLE_BUTTON_13
  20. #define PROGRAMMABLE_BUTTON_14 QK_PROGRAMMABLE_BUTTON_14
  21. #define PROGRAMMABLE_BUTTON_15 QK_PROGRAMMABLE_BUTTON_15
  22. #define PROGRAMMABLE_BUTTON_16 QK_PROGRAMMABLE_BUTTON_16
  23. #define PROGRAMMABLE_BUTTON_17 QK_PROGRAMMABLE_BUTTON_17
  24. #define PROGRAMMABLE_BUTTON_18 QK_PROGRAMMABLE_BUTTON_18
  25. #define PROGRAMMABLE_BUTTON_19 QK_PROGRAMMABLE_BUTTON_19
  26. #define PROGRAMMABLE_BUTTON_20 QK_PROGRAMMABLE_BUTTON_20
  27. #define PROGRAMMABLE_BUTTON_21 QK_PROGRAMMABLE_BUTTON_21
  28. #define PROGRAMMABLE_BUTTON_22 QK_PROGRAMMABLE_BUTTON_22
  29. #define PROGRAMMABLE_BUTTON_23 QK_PROGRAMMABLE_BUTTON_23
  30. #define PROGRAMMABLE_BUTTON_24 QK_PROGRAMMABLE_BUTTON_24
  31. #define PROGRAMMABLE_BUTTON_25 QK_PROGRAMMABLE_BUTTON_25
  32. #define PROGRAMMABLE_BUTTON_26 QK_PROGRAMMABLE_BUTTON_26
  33. #define PROGRAMMABLE_BUTTON_27 QK_PROGRAMMABLE_BUTTON_27
  34. #define PROGRAMMABLE_BUTTON_28 QK_PROGRAMMABLE_BUTTON_28
  35. #define PROGRAMMABLE_BUTTON_29 QK_PROGRAMMABLE_BUTTON_29
  36. #define PROGRAMMABLE_BUTTON_30 QK_PROGRAMMABLE_BUTTON_30
  37. #define PROGRAMMABLE_BUTTON_31 QK_PROGRAMMABLE_BUTTON_31
  38. #define PROGRAMMABLE_BUTTON_32 QK_PROGRAMMABLE_BUTTON_32
  39. #define JS_BUTTON0 QK_JOYSTICK_BUTTON_0
  40. #define JS_BUTTON1 QK_JOYSTICK_BUTTON_1
  41. #define JS_BUTTON2 QK_JOYSTICK_BUTTON_2
  42. #define JS_BUTTON3 QK_JOYSTICK_BUTTON_3
  43. #define JS_BUTTON4 QK_JOYSTICK_BUTTON_4
  44. #define JS_BUTTON5 QK_JOYSTICK_BUTTON_5
  45. #define JS_BUTTON6 QK_JOYSTICK_BUTTON_6
  46. #define JS_BUTTON7 QK_JOYSTICK_BUTTON_7
  47. #define JS_BUTTON8 QK_JOYSTICK_BUTTON_8
  48. #define JS_BUTTON9 QK_JOYSTICK_BUTTON_9
  49. #define JS_BUTTON10 QK_JOYSTICK_BUTTON_10
  50. #define JS_BUTTON11 QK_JOYSTICK_BUTTON_11
  51. #define JS_BUTTON12 QK_JOYSTICK_BUTTON_12
  52. #define JS_BUTTON13 QK_JOYSTICK_BUTTON_13
  53. #define JS_BUTTON14 QK_JOYSTICK_BUTTON_14
  54. #define JS_BUTTON15 QK_JOYSTICK_BUTTON_15
  55. #define JS_BUTTON16 QK_JOYSTICK_BUTTON_16
  56. #define JS_BUTTON17 QK_JOYSTICK_BUTTON_17
  57. #define JS_BUTTON18 QK_JOYSTICK_BUTTON_18
  58. #define JS_BUTTON19 QK_JOYSTICK_BUTTON_19
  59. #define JS_BUTTON20 QK_JOYSTICK_BUTTON_20
  60. #define JS_BUTTON21 QK_JOYSTICK_BUTTON_21
  61. #define JS_BUTTON22 QK_JOYSTICK_BUTTON_22
  62. #define JS_BUTTON23 QK_JOYSTICK_BUTTON_23
  63. #define JS_BUTTON24 QK_JOYSTICK_BUTTON_24
  64. #define JS_BUTTON25 QK_JOYSTICK_BUTTON_25
  65. #define JS_BUTTON26 QK_JOYSTICK_BUTTON_26
  66. #define JS_BUTTON27 QK_JOYSTICK_BUTTON_27
  67. #define JS_BUTTON28 QK_JOYSTICK_BUTTON_28
  68. #define JS_BUTTON29 QK_JOYSTICK_BUTTON_29
  69. #define JS_BUTTON30 QK_JOYSTICK_BUTTON_30
  70. #define JS_BUTTON31 QK_JOYSTICK_BUTTON_31
  71. #define TERM_ON _Static_assert(false, "The Terminal feature has been removed from QMK. Please remove use of TERM_ON/TERM_OFF from your keymap.")
  72. #define TERM_OFF _Static_assert(false, "The Terminal feature has been removed from QMK.. Please remove use of TERM_ON/TERM_OFF from your keymap.")
  73. // #define RESET _Static_assert(false, "The RESET keycode has been removed from QMK.. Please remove use from your keymap.")